What is Gemfibrozil?
Gemfibrozil is a generic compound that belongs to the class of medications known as fibric acid derivatives. It is primarily used to help reduce levels of triglycerides and, to a lesser extent, cholesterol in the bloodstream. Elevated triglycerides are often linked to various health issues, including heart disease and pancreatitis, making Gemfibrozil crucial for managing these risks.
Originally approved for use in the 198s, Gemfibrozil has since become widely utilized in managing dyslipidemiaβa condition characterized by abnormal levels of lipids in the blood. How Gemfibrozil Works: Understanding Its Mechanism of Action
Gemfibrozil works primarily by activating a specific receptor known as peroxisome proliferator-activated receptor alpha (PPAR-alpha). When activated, this receptor plays a role in enhancing the breakdown of fatty acids and promoting the clearance of triglycerides from the blood.
In simpler terms, Gemfibrozil encourages your body to process fats more efficiently, which can lead to lower triglyceride levels. This can help reduce the risk of heart-related complications that arise from high lipid levels. Its effectiveness is often paired with lifestyle changes, such as diet and exercise, for optimal results.
What Conditions Does Gemfibrozil Address?
Gemfibrozil is primarily indicated for patients with high triglyceride levels, especially when these levels pose a risk of pancreatitis. Individuals who have not responded well to dietary interventions alone may find Gemfibrozil beneficial.

Understanding Gemfibrozil's Therapeutic Class
As a member of the fibric acid derivative class, Gemfibrozil stands out among lipid-lowering agents. Unlike statins, which primarily target LDL cholesterol, Gemfibrozil focuses on lowering triglycerides and raising HDL cholesterol, often referred to as "good" cholesterol.
This distinction is essential for patients whose lipid profiles do not respond adequately to first-line treatments. For instance, while a patient might take a statin to lower LDL cholesterol, they may also need Gemfibrozil to address high triglycerides, creating a multifaceted approach to lipid management.

Drug Interactions and Contraindications of Gemfibrozil
Known Drug Interactions
Gemfibrozil can interact with various medications, leading to potential complications. For example, when taken alongside statins, the risk of muscle-related side effects increases. An illustrative scenario would involve a patient who is currently on a statin for cholesterol management and begins taking Gemfibrozil without informing their healthcare provider, potentially leading to serious muscle damage.
Contraindications
Patients with liver or kidney impairment should avoid using Gemfibrozil, as it may exacerbate existing conditions. It's crucial for patients to inform their healthcare providers of any previous kidney or liver issues to prevent adverse reactions.
Potential Side Effects and Risks of Gemfibrozil
Like any medication, Gemfibrozil can have side effects that patients should be aware of.
Rare Side Effects
Some rare side effects include severe allergic reactions or liver issues. Patients should be vigilant for any unusual symptoms and seek medical attention if they arise.
Common Side Effects
More common side effects often include gastrointestinal symptoms such as nausea, diarrhea, or abdominal pain. These side effects can sometimes be managed by adjusting the dosing schedule or administration timing.
Serious Side Effects
Serious side effects, while rare, can include muscle pain or weakness, which may indicate a serious condition called rhabdomyolysis. Patients experiencing such symptoms should report them immediately to their healthcare provider.
Proper Usage: Missed Doses and Overdose Actions
If a dose of Gemfibrozil is missed, patients should take it as soon as they remember. However, if it is close to the time for the next dose, skip the missed doseβnever double up.
In the case of overdose, which might present as severe dizziness, stomach pain, or ongoing nausea, immediate medical attention is necessary.
Gemfibrozil is usually taken with meals to enhance its absorption, making it essential to follow the prescribed timing closely.

Importing Gemfibrozil for Personal Use in Singapore
For those considering importing Gemfibrozil for personal use, itβs essential to be aware of local regulations. Generally, Singapore permits individuals to import a maximum three-month supply of personal medications. Always ensure that medications are in original packaging and accompanied by a valid prescription or doctorβs letter.
